#e63e6f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e63e6f is composed of 90.2% red, 24.3%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73% magenta, 51.7%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 342.5 degrees, a saturation of 77.1% and a lightness of 57.3%. #e63e6f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7cde with #cd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3366.

#e63e6f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e63e6f has RGB values of R:230, G:62, B:111 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.73, Y:0.52,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15089263.
